  • Abstract
    This work focuses upon dipole antenna-coupled metal-oxide-metal diodes, which detect long wave infrared radiation. These detectors offer CMOS compatible fabrication in a small pixel footprint, high speed and frequency selective detection, and full functionality at room temperature. These devices can be fabricated by either of two methods, both of which provide for the aforementioned device characteristics. In addition, the detection characteristics can be tailored to provide for multi-spectral imaging in specific applications by modifying device geometries.
